If you've never trained or set foot in a dojang, that's exactly who a good beginners program is for. A few things worth knowing before your first week. First, you don't need to be fit or flexible to start — you get in shape by training, not before it, and instructors scale the intensity to you. Second, you won't be thrown into hard sparring — reputable schools build fundamentals (stances, blocks, kicks, and basic forms) for weeks, sparring eases in gradually and with gear on, and instructors keep it controlled and safe. Third, all ages and all levels really are welcome — ask about a dedicated beginners or fundamentals class time so your first session is alongside others who are also starting out. Most schools are happy to let you watch or try a class first, so reach out before you commit.

Nervous about walking into a taekwondo school for the first time? Almost everyone is, and good instructors expect beginners to come through the door. Here's what to know. What to expect: a typical first class is a warm-up, then drilling basic stances, blocks, and kicks with a partner or on pads — not hard sparring. Rest whenever you need to; no one will bat an eye. What to wear: loose athletic wear you can move in (or a dobok if you have one); you'll train barefoot on the floor. What to bring: water and a positive attitude — many schools lend a loaner dobok for a first class, so it's worth asking when you call. As you keep training you'll get your own dobok and belt, and sparring gear (mouthguard, headgear, and guards) once you begin sparring. Sparring eases in gradually, once your fundamentals and forms are solid. Arrive 10–15 minutes early to sign a waiver and meet the instructor. It gets easier fast — most people feel far more at home by their third class.
